The most important part about being a nanny...

Being a nanny, it’s important to me that I’m not just looking after the child, but also using my time with them effectively. At such a young age it’s so important to continuously work with them to develop their fine and gross motor skills, which shouldn’t stop just because the parents are not present. As I said before, I love finding fun and interactive ways to get a child using their hands or moving around! Even below 1 year old, I think it’s important to stimulate their minds in a fun and practical way, whether it be through tummy time and a book or sitting up and playing with sensory toys.

My experience with special needs children...

As an intern for children with autism, I have many hours of experience in handling kids who may not fully understand how to regulate their emotions or communicate their needs just yet. Many of the kids I worked with were non-verbal, using simple sign language to communicate (more, all-done, etc.). One of the many things I learned was how to handle emotional outbursts and to observe when to give a child some space as to not overstimulate them.
